Pick out the wrong unit conversion of temperature?
Correct answer: A. °R = 273 + °F
- A. °R = 273 + °F
- B. Temperature difference of 1°K = 1°C = 9/5°F
- C. °C = (F- 32) × 0.555
- D. °F = (°C + 17.778) × 1.8
Explanation
The Rankine conversion is °R = °F + 459.67, not °F + 273. The other expressions correctly represent temperature differences or the Celsius-Fahrenheit conversion.
